模糊相似矩阵与布尔矩阵法在数据分类中的应用

需积分: 32 71 下载量 129 浏览量 更新于2024-08-08 收藏 5.61MB PDF 举报
"布尔矩阵法-omap-l138中文数据手册" 布尔矩阵法是一种在数学建模和数据处理中常用的技术,特别是在模糊系统理论和聚类分析中。它基于模糊相似矩阵来对数据进行分类。当面对一组数据,我们希望根据它们之间的相似性或关系进行划分时,布尔矩阵法便能发挥作用。 首先,我们需要理解模糊相似矩阵(R)。这是一个描述数据元素间模糊关系的矩阵,其中的每个元素表示一对数据元素之间的相似程度,通常取值在[0,1]之间,1代表完全相同,0代表完全不同。传递闭包法是从模糊相似矩阵出发,通过计算矩阵的传递闭包(Rt),即所有可能的相似关系的组合,来生成一个模糊等价矩阵(*R)。这个过程有助于识别那些具有强关联性的数据元素,并形成不同类别。 布尔矩阵法的具体步骤如下: 1. 定义一个λ水平,它是一个介于0和1之间的阈值,用于决定哪些相似程度被认为足够强,足以将数据元素归入同一类。 2. 应用λ截矩阵操作,即选取大于λ的矩阵元素,这些元素表示超过λ水平的相似性。 3. 根据λ截矩阵,数据元素被分为不同的类别,因为超过λ水平的相似性意味着元素应被归入同一类。 4. 结果可表现为动态聚类图,这种图可以清晰地展示随着λ水平变化,数据元素如何在类别间移动。 除了布尔矩阵法,描述中还提到了其他数学建模算法,如线性规划、整数规划、非线性规划和动态规划。线性规划是一种优化技术,用于在满足一系列线性约束条件下最大化或最小化目标函数。整数规划是线性规划的扩展,要求决策变量必须取整数值。非线性规划涉及处理目标函数或约束条件为非线性的情况。动态规划则是解决多阶段决策问题的方法,通过找到最优策略来最大化或最小化长期效果。 在实际应用中,这些算法广泛应用于各个领域,如物流、金融投资、生产计划、资源分配等。例如,线性规划常用于解决运输问题和指派问题,整数规划在处理包含整数决策变量的问题时非常有效,非线性规划则在处理曲线拟合、最优化设计等问题上不可或缺,而动态规划则在诸如库存管理、项目调度等领域发挥关键作用。 布尔矩阵法是一种利用模糊相似矩阵进行数据分类的方法,它与其他数学建模算法如线性规划、整数规划、非线性规划和动态规划一起,构成了解决复杂问题的重要工具箱。理解并熟练掌握这些方法,对于解决实际中的数据处理和决策优化问题至关重要。